        Couple different ways to define a good chin.

        Did Holyfield have a great chin? He was hurt repeatedly throughout his career but once you hurt him he was practically impossible to stop.

        Some say Tyson had a great beard and sure he could take a decent amount of punishment but once he started taking it he was done dishing it out.

        In todays game I look at Antonio Margarito as a guy that will be damn tough to hurt....he keeps coming never deterred....great chin.

        Jessie Feliciano may not be an elite level of fighter but I dont think there is a better beard in the game-he took countless shots against Cintron (who could be the sports best puncher p4p) and kept coming it was an amazing display of CHIN.
